About this House

This single-family home is located at 237 R St NE, Washington, DC. 237 R St NE is in the NoMa neighborhood in Washington, DC and in ZIP code 20002. This property has 3 bedrooms, 2 bathrooms and approximately 1,668 sqft of floor space. This property has a lot size of 1620 sqft and was built in 1900.
237 R St NE, Washington, DC 20002 is a 3 bedroom, 2 bathroom, 1,668 sqft single-family home in NoMa, built in 1900. It last sold for $409,900 on Aug 6, 2004. It is currently off market. The Trulia Estimate is $753,000, with a rent estimate of $4,206/month.
